Synthwave Night Drive Anthem
The style line front-loads everything Suno needs — genre, era, instruments, tempo, vocal type — before a single lyric, and the section tags give the song an actual arc instead of one endless loop. Concrete images like dashboard lights beat abstract feelings every time. Adaptation idea: keep the structure, drop the tempo to 85 BPM and swap the tags to chillwave for a comedown version.
